Australia Temporary Skill Shortage (TSS) Visa (Subclass 482)

Organizations hiring skilled workers through Working Visa Australia seek staff from the Temporary Skill Shortage program, which lets enterprises fill vacant positions because no local candidates are available. It has three streams:

  1. Short-term stream: Valid for up to 2 years
  2. Medium-term stream: Valid for up to 4 years
  3. Labour Agreement offers special work permits to specific employers and their employees.

This Working Visa Australia requires qualifying job seekers to provide these criteria.

  • You need an employer in Australia who satisfies government standards
  • Show that you have the necessary professional skills along with the required educational background in English.
  • Pass health and character checks.

The TSS visa application success rate was around 95% in 2024, making it a popular Working Visa Australia choice for skilled workers, including those applying for an Australia work visa for Indians.

Australia Skilled Independent Visa (Subclass 189)

The Skilled Independent visa gives un-sponsored skilled workers permanent residency status in Australia through a points system. This Work Permit in Australia presents multiple benefits to applicants. Australian skilled migration is a pathway for skilled workers to gain permanent residency Australia.

  • No need for an employer or state sponsorship
  • You can easily establish residence and take any job in Australia under this visa.
  • It leads to a long-term residency status in Australia

A foreign worker seeking the Australia Working Visa must meet three application requirements.

  • Apply for the Expression of Interest document by using the SkillSelect online tool.
  • Receive an invitation to apply
  • You must earn 65 points on the points test evaluation.

This visa is particularly attractive for foreigners seeking an Australia work visa as it offers long-term prospects in Australia.

Australian Immigration Points System 2025

A minimum score of 65 points is usually needed to be eligible for a skilled visa under Australia’s merit-based immigration points system, which awards points to prospective immigrants based on variables like age, education level, English language proficiency, job experience, and abilities.

The Working Visa Australia Application Process in 2025

To seek a Working Visa in Australia, one needs to complete various procedures. Here’s a detailed guide to help you navigate the Australia work visa process:

  1. Choose the right visa subclass: The visa subclass corresponds to your skills, qualifications, and occupational targets. Your decision to choose a Working Visa Australia should depend on your occupation, work history, and future Australian Select objectives.
  2. Check your eligibility: Ensure you meet all the Australia work visa requirements for your chosen visa, including age limits, skills, and qualifications. You should use online tools available on the Department of Home Affairs website to evaluate your visa eligibility.
  3. Gather required documents: Accumulate all essential documentation, including your passport, skill evaluation reports, language test results, and academic testimonies. Every document written in a foreign language needs translation by an officially certified translator into English.
  4. Submit an Expression of Interest (if applicable): If the Skilled Independent visa requires it, applicants must submit an Expression of Interest through SkillSelect. This step proves essential to receiving an invitation for application submission.
  5. Receive an invitation to apply (if applicable): If your visa requires intervention by the Department of Home Affairs, you must wait for them to send you an invitation. The issuing of invitations depends on your points score and occupational background.
  6. Lodge your visa application: Make your visa application through ImmiAccount while attaching all necessary documents along with payment of required fees. Make sure that the provided information agrees exactly with the supporting documentation.
  7. Undergo health and character checks: The applicant needs to fulfill health examinations while providing requested police clearance certificates. All visa seekers, along with their application dependents, need to complete medical and character background checks.
  8. Wait for the decision: Application processing takes different amounts of time; therefore, you must wait respectfully without rushing while immediately responding to any document requests. The status of your application can be checked by using your ImmiAccount.

When applying for a Working Visa Australia, you should avoid three main mistakes: Sending applications with missing information, providing incorrect details, or missing English language standard requirements. The proper review of your application materials before submission will minimize delays along with potential rejection cases.

Australia Work Visa Fees in 2025: A Complete Breakdown

Budgeting depends heavily on knowing the expenses required to obtain a Working Visa Australia. Here’s a breakdown of the main Australia work visa fees:

Visa Type Base Application Fee (AUD) Additional Applicant Fee (AUD)
TSS Visa 1,265 1,265 (adult), 320 (child)
Skilled Independent 4,115 2,060 (adult), 1,030 (child)
Skilled Nominated 4,115 2,060 (adult), 1,030 (child)
Skilled Work Regional 4,115 2,060 (adult), 1,030 (child)
Global Talent 4,115 2,060 (adult), 1,030 (child)

 

Note: These Australia work visa fees are subject to change. Always check the official Department of Home Affairs website for the most up-to-date information.

Additional costs to consider in the Australia work visa process:

  • Skills assessment fees (vary by occupation, typically 300-1,000 AUD)
  • English language test fees (e.g., IELTS: ~300 AUD, PTE: ~330 AUD)
  • Health examination fees (~300 AUD per person)
  • Police clearance certificate fees (vary by country, usually 50-150 AUD)
  • Migration agent fees, if applicable (~2,000 – 5,000 AUD)
  • Travel costs and initial settlement expenses

It’s important to factor in these costs when planning your move to Australia. Some employers may cover certain fees for sponsored visas, so it’s worth discussing this during your job negotiations. Additionally, consider exchange rates and potential bank fees when transferring money for visa applications.

Post Study Work Visa Australia in 2025

For international students who have completed their studies in Australia, the post-study work visa Australia (subclass 485) offers an excellent opportunity to gain valuable work experience and potentially transition to other Working Visa Australia options. This visa allows you to:

  • You can perform full-time work in Australia right after you graduate.
  • The work experience you gain during your study will prepare you for your professional field.
  • You can apply to keep working in Australia plus pursue more skilled visas or permanent immigration programs.

Key features of the post-study work visa Australia

  • The visa duration is 2-4 years, depending on your completed qualification type
  • This visa gives you the freedom to choose any work you want while learning various professions.
  • Option to bring family members
  • You can enter and leave Australia as needed because of this visa type.

To qualify for the visa, you need to fulfill certain requirements

  • You need to have finished a CRICOS-approved Australian educational program within the last half-year
  • You need to show proof of English language proficiency at the IELTS 6.0 level or a similar level of skill.
  • Hold an eligible student visa
  • Be under 50 years of age
  • Meet health and character requirements

The post-study work visa Australia serves as an excellent pathway for international students to kickstart their careers in Australia. This visa gives people a valuable period to work locally while building professional relationships, and they may qualify for additional skilled visas.
